How to Use Automation to Streamline Your Support Processes with CRM

Customer relationship management (CRM) is a powerful tool for streamlining customer support processes. Automation is a key component of CRM, allowing businesses to automate mundane tasks and free up time for more important customer service activities. Here are some ways to use automation to streamline your support processes with CRM:

1. Automate customer data collection. Automation can be used to collect customer data such as contact information, purchase history, and preferences. This data can then be used to personalize customer service interactions and provide more tailored support.

2. Automate customer segmentation. Automation can be used to segment customers into different groups based on their preferences and behaviors. This allows businesses to provide more targeted support and tailor their services to meet the needs of each customer segment.

3. Automate customer communication. Automation can be used to send automated emails, text messages, and other forms of communication to customers. This allows businesses to stay in touch with customers and provide timely support.

4. Automate customer feedback. Automation can be used to collect customer feedback and reviews. This allows businesses to gain valuable insights into customer satisfaction and make improvements to their services.

By leveraging automation, businesses can streamline their customer support processes and provide better service to their customers. Automation can help businesses save time and resources, while also providing a better customer experience.

Best Practices for Offering Support Across Multiple Channels with CRM

Offering support across multiple channels is an important part of customer relationship management (CRM). It allows businesses to provide customers with the best possible service and build strong relationships with them. Here are some best practices for offering support across multiple channels with CRM:

1. Establish a Clear Support Strategy: Before offering support across multiple channels, it is important to establish a clear support strategy. This should include the channels you will use, the types of support you will provide, and the resources you will need to provide it.

2. Utilize Automation: Automation can be a great way to streamline the support process and ensure that customers get the help they need quickly and efficiently. Automation can also help reduce the amount of time and resources needed to provide support.

3. Monitor and Respond to Customer Feedback: It is important to monitor customer feedback across all channels and respond to it in a timely manner. This will help ensure that customers feel heard and that their issues are being addressed.

4. Track and Analyze Data: Tracking and analyzing data from customer interactions across multiple channels can help you identify areas where you can improve your support process. This data can also be used to identify trends and patterns in customer behavior.

5. Invest in Training: Investing in training for your support team can help ensure that they are able to provide the best possible service to customers. This can include training on the use of the CRM system, as well as customer service best practices.

By following these best practices, businesses can ensure that they are providing the best possible support across multiple channels with CRM. This will help them build strong relationships with their customers and provide them with the best possible service.
